Physical properties

Fine-grained, dark gray to black, with a dull to mildly vitreous luster; typically massive and non-cleaved. Hardness is about 5–6 Mohs and specific gravity about 2.8–3.0; the smooth surface indicates tumbling or polishing.

Formation & geological history

Basalt forms when mafic lava rapidly cools at or near Earth’s surface, commonly in volcanic fields and oceanic crust. Most examples are geologically young, though basalt occurs from Archean rocks to present-day eruptions.

Uses & applications

Used as aggregate, roadstone, building stone, and occasionally as a decorative or meditation stone when polished. Ordinary tumbled pieces have little commercial value.

Field identification & locations

Check for tiny crystalline grains, a streak that is gray rather than metallic, and lack of strong cleavage; basalt is not attracted to a magnet unless it contains abundant magnetite. Common sources include Hawaii, Iceland, India, and oceanic volcanic regions.
